Action item (incident 'Saltmarsh webhook storm'): retries currently hammer slow endpoints with fixed intervals. Switch Driftpipe delivery to exponential backoff with jitter, cap total attempts, and dead-letter afterward. Contractor onboarding note: do not invent values; all retry behavior must come from the shared constants table that follows.

constants for tafog-kahag:
RATE_LIMITS = {
    "sorir": 697,
    "oliox": 683,
    "holax": 176,
    "casox": 60,
    "pelius": 382,
}

## Break-Glass: Undo/Redo in Sketchfell

Undo stack in Sketchfell diagram editor caps at 200 steps. Redo clears on any new edit. Corrupted history manifests as greyed-out undo with edits present — known bug, fixed in 3.9. Support can replay the journal from the admin console to restore a user's last session. Journal replay is destructive; get user consent first. Console access requires break-glass mode during outages. To enter break-glass mode, supply the recovery passphrase printed below.

unlock words, kagef-taduf: fenir-quenix-norwyn-sorvan-gormir-gorir-fraok

Who to Contact: Encoding Detection (Uploadery)

If you're reviewing the charset sniffer in Uploadery's text-upload path, a few pointers. The detection library is maintained in-house, so don't file issues upstream. Anything touching the byte-sampling window or the fallback-to-Latin-1 logic counts as security-relevant and needs a second reviewer. For threat-model questions, audit findings, or a walkthrough of the detection heuristics, write to the ingestion security lead at the address below.

escalation mailbox, hadug-bajog: sormir@norvalabs.internal

**Key Ceremony Checklist — Step 12 (LiftSim)**

Almost done! Once the signing laptop for the Cartwheel elevator-dispatch simulator is wiped, re-enroll the LiftSim build keys and run one dispatch scenario end to end — Tower B, morning rush preset. If floors queue correctly, the keys are good. Future maintainers: the sim's sealed config won't open without a recovery step, so keep the passphrase below in the ceremony binder.

recovery phrase for fahap-haduf: casvan-eliius-novmir-holiel-oliwyn-brivan-gilax-gilael-gilax-wenius-rusael-istius-ralys-julwyn